Is there such a thing as a true coincidence or is life a series of carefully planned events? 

Ellie Mack seemed to have the perfect life. She was the apple of her mom Laurie’s eye. Smart and beautiful, Ellie had the entire world ahead of her. Then one day, shortly before her school exams, she disappeared. The police chalked Ellie’s disappearance up as a runaway teenager, but Laurie knew her daughter and she knew that Ellie wouldn’t have just ran away without a word to anyone. 

Years later, a chance encounter at a coffee shop causes Laurie to meet Floyd, a single father of two daughters. After years of heartache, Laurie is finally open to the idea of love and embraces the idea of being a mother figure to Floyd’s younger daughter, Poppy, a precocious preteen girl whose own mother abandoned her years before. Laurie’s vision of a perfect blended family is shattered when she meets Poppy, who looks just like Ellie. This meeting causes Laurie to wonder if meeting Floyd and Poppy was a coincidence or is there a sinister connection to Ellie’s disappearance

The premise of this book was good enough for me to pick it up, but it was so predictable that I had to force myself to read it. 

Most of the "twists" are revealed in the first half of the book and the second half is just an in depth look into what happened. I read and read hoping something more would happen, but was sadly disappointed.

Jewell, in her acknowledgements says that this is either "brilliantly bizarre, or just bizarre." And I have to agree. I love thrillers, but this was just an awfully sad story about a girl who is kidnapped.
